回覆列表
  • 1 # 使用者7272742818983

    博途的理念是軟體大整合主要整合STEP7,WINCC,STARTDRIVE等,工程師只需要用博途一個軟體就能對觸控式螢幕,PLC,驅動進行程式設計除錯。使程式設計更容易,提供更友好的開發環境,更方便的組態硬體設定網路。想法確實不錯,但是軟體大了自然對安裝的電腦硬體配置就高了。博途V15剛出的時候,我也嘗試用了一段時間,經常程式寫到一半就崩潰了。不過令人欣喜的是經歷瞭如此多的版本最後V15終於穩定了。

    開啟TIA Portal V15 的圖示稍等片刻,左邊竟然出現很多神奇的東西.

    1:裝置與網路,應該屬於硬體組態部分

    2:PLC程式設計

    3:運動控制技術,說明運動控制越來越重要了

    4 :視覺化,應該是HMI

    5:線上診斷。

    先新建個專案先

    西門子PLC博圖V15編寫程式

    讓我們一步步跟著博圖來。先來添加個硬體裝置,我先來添加個1500PLC控制器。

    西門子PLC博圖V15編寫程式

    點選進入PLC裝置組態,發現介面佈局和STEP7的硬體組態的介面區別還是很大的。最喜歡左邊的“專案樹”,樹形目錄很方便在各個畫面之間切換。中間是PLC硬體組態,底部是屬性介面跟隨中間不同硬體直接切換對於硬體的屬性,不像STEP那樣需要雙擊彈出框。底部屬性框內左邊還有樹形目錄,右邊屬性設定。看到這個介面如果你的顯示器是大屏高解析度用博圖會更順手。

    西門子PLC博圖V15編寫程式

    西門子PLC博圖V15編寫程式

    觸控式螢幕選完後直接能提示連線到PLC是不是很方便呀

    西門子PLC博圖V15編寫程式

    直接進行連結,真的挺直觀的。

    西門子PLC博圖V15編寫程式

    好了硬體組完了先來試試程式設計吧,開啟OB1發現程式段插入SCL也能插LAD,混合程式設計確實讓程式設計更靈活,另外發現輸入地址不再是IX.X了,變成了%IX.X。而且地址必須捆綁變數。

    西門子PLC博圖V15編寫程式

    那好吧,還是先定義變數吧,變數名還能直接中文。同時變數可以勾選HMI的讀寫許可權

    西門子PLC博圖V15編寫程式

    變數定義好了,開始寫個小程式吧。我現在喜歡SCL那就用SCL來寫一個,插入個if語句

    西門子PLC博圖V15編寫程式

    用剛剛定義的變數填寫進去,反正SCL的語句各家PLC差距更小。這就是我喜歡的原因,換PLC移植程式起來也方便。

    西門子PLC博圖V15編寫程式

    好啦程式寫完了,小夥伴們是不是會使用博途V15編寫程式啦。

  • 中秋節和大豐收的關聯?
  • 至今,你有哪些後悔的事?